Page MenuHomePhabricator

[native] introduce nav logic for ThreadSettingsNotifications
ClosedPublic

Authored by ginsu on Jul 2 2024, 6:06 PM.
Tags
None
Referenced Files
F3574644: D12642.diff
Sat, Dec 28, 5:53 PM
Unknown Object (File)
Sun, Dec 22, 5:00 PM
Unknown Object (File)
Wed, Dec 18, 1:43 AM
Unknown Object (File)
Sun, Dec 8, 10:50 PM
Unknown Object (File)
Sun, Dec 8, 9:15 AM
Unknown Object (File)
Fri, Dec 6, 2:14 PM
Unknown Object (File)
Wed, Dec 4, 9:11 PM
Unknown Object (File)
Nov 11 2024, 5:31 AM
Subscribers

Details

Summary

For the new thread notif settings we decided that we want this user experience to have it's own page. This diff introduces the nave logic needed for this

Linear task: https://linear.app/comm/issue/ENG-7776/improve-thread-notifications-settings-user-experience

Test Plan

Confirmed that I can navigate to this screen

Diff Detail

Repository
rCOMM Comm
Lint
No Lint Coverage
Unit
No Test Coverage

Event Timeline

native/chat/chat.react.js
335–337 ↗(On Diff #41918)

Confirmed this is the same behavior with web

nonsidebar:

Screenshot 2024-07-02 at 9.07.21 PM.png (2×3 px, 1 MB)

sidebar:

Screenshot 2024-07-02 at 9.07.31 PM.png (2×3 px, 950 KB)

Harbormaster returned this revision to the author for changes because remote builds failed.Jul 2 2024, 6:22 PM
Harbormaster failed remote builds in B30067: Diff 41918!
native/chat/chat.react.js
335–337

Confirmed this is the same behavior with web

nonsidebar:

Screenshot 2024-07-02 at 9.07.21 PM.png (2×3 px, 1 MB)

sidebar:

Screenshot 2024-07-02 at 9.07.31 PM.png (2×3 px, 950 KB)

ginsu requested review of this revision.Jul 2 2024, 6:52 PM
This revision is now accepted and ready to land.Jul 2 2024, 7:14 PM